ADP Inspection

Form ID: (MPPP3160)

The ADP inspection window provides insight into how the Average Daily Pay rate (ADP) was calculated for an employee, displaying the gross liable income and whole/part days worked for the past 52 weeks. This screen is only accessible from the Employee Leave Summary (NZ) (MPPP4045) screen.

Summary Area

This area displays read-only details about the employee and the values used to calculate their ADP rate.

Element Description
Employee ID The unique ID of the employee associated with the leave transaction.
Pay Run ID The unique ID of the pay run associated with the leave transaction.
Pay Item ID The unique ID of the pay item associated with the leave transaction.
Date From The start date of the leave taken.
Date To The end date of the leave taken.
Applied Total Gross Liable The total gross liable income calculated for the past 52 weeks when the leave was first captured. This can be different from the Current Total Gross Liable, if pay adjustments are made after applying for the leave.
Applied Total Whole or Part Days Worked The total whole/part days worked for the past 52 weeks when the leave was first captured. This can be different from the Current Total Whole or Part Days Worked, if employee schedule changes are made after applying for the leave.
Applied Calculated ADP Rate The calculated ADP rate applied to the leave transaction when the leave was first captured. This can be different from the current calculated ADP rate, if pay adjustments or employee schedule changes are made after applying for the leave.
Current Total Gross Liable The total gross liable income calculated for the past 52 weeks at present.
Current Total Whole or Part Days Worked The total whole/part days worked calculated for the past 52 weeks at present.
Current Calculated ADP Rate The calculated ADP rate calculated using the current total gross liable and current total whole/part days worked.

Main Table

The main table displays details of the pay runs used in the calculation of the ADP rate.

Element Description
Pay Run ID The unique ID of the pay run for which the contributing gross liable income is determined.
Description Descriptive text for the pay run.
Physical Pay Day The date on which employees will receive their pay for this pay run.
Pay Period Start Date The date on which the pay period that this pay run applies to began.
Pay Period End Date The date on which the pay period that this pay run applies to ended.
Total Gross Liable The total gross liable income calculated for the pay run. The gross liable income uses the ADP Liable Income definition set on the Pay Item Liabilities (MPPP1025) screen. Use this screen to include or exclude liable pay items.
Whole or Part Days Worked The total whole/part days worked that is associated with the pay run. This field is derived from the Employee Work Schedule (MPPP2260) screen. Use this screen to make the necessary adjustments to hours worked by the employee, bearing in mind that scheduled hours used may affect historic ADP leave payments.
